Swifties Defending Taylor Against Lindsay Lohan
Taylor Swift hopped on Instagram Live recently to announce the release of her new album, “Lover.” But the comments section attracted more attention than the initial video when Lindsay Lohan got involved, posting a series of strange comments on Taylor’s video.
The comments included stream-of-consciousness musings like, “We think you’re great!” “You should respond!” And also, “my mom was in cats.”
The last Tweet was presumably a reference to the musical “Cats.” Swift reportedly has a role in the revival show.
Maybe Lohan is just an enthusiastic fan, and we can’t blame her. Just a month after dropping a new single, “ME!”, Swift released another song, “You Need to Calm Down.” Some followers are convinced the new song is a Gay Pride anthem that takes shots at President Trump.
The lyrics to “You Need to Calm Down” include: “Sunshine on the street at the parade, but you would rather be in the dark ages” and “Shade never made anybody less gay.”
Coincidentally, Swift dropped the new single on President Trump’s birthday. It’s all part of a trend of Swift becoming more politically outspoken, despite keeping mum about her beliefs in the past.
Still, Lindsay Lohan might “need to calm down” in her favorite singer’s comment section. Even reality TV star and notorious fame-seeker Spencer Pratt commented, “Someone please tell Lohan settle down on Tays live like dang gurl.”
